Joe Manganiello is bringing his love of Dungeons & Dragons to life in a new documentary backed by Hasbro.

According to Variety, the 45-year-old actor will co-direct the pic with Kyle Newman, and it’s billed as “the definitive documentary feature about the world’s greatest roleplaying game”. “I couldn’t be more proud and excited to get back behind the camera for another documentary, this time with the D&D dream team of Jon, Kyle and my brother and producing partner Nick,” Joe shared in a statement. “I lived through the rise and fall and rise again of this legacy brand that has not only meant so much to me but has served as the fountainhead of creativity for an entire generation of writers, artists and creative minds, influencing so much of our culture.” The D&D documentary is timed to the 50th anniversary of the game in 2024, and will incorporate more than 400 hours of archived, never-before-seen “Dungeons & Dragons” footage from the game’s creation in the early 1970s.

It will also include interviews with celebrity fans of the game. Just recently, Joe and fellow celeb D&D fan Stephen Colbert, spoke about their love for the fantasy game.
